Description: Collins Caring Corner is a Licensed Group Child Care in Milwaukee WI, with a maximum capacity of 24 children. This child care center helps with children in the age range of 4 Week(s) - 18 Year(s). The provider does not participate in a subsidized child care program.

Violation Date | Rule Number | Rule Summary |
---|---|---|
2020-01-09 | 251.04(8)(b) | Biennial Training - Child Abuse & Neglect |
Description: Staff B has not completed the required biennial child abuse/neglect training every two years. The most recent training certificate on file for Staff B expired in September of 2019. | ||
2020-01-09 | 251.06(9)(d)1.a. | Food Storage - Perishable, Potentially Hazardous Food |
Description: Bowls containing leftover prepared beef a roni and green beans that were served for lunch at 11:30 remain unrefrigerated when they are observed on the kitchen counter at 1:30 P.M. The food was not maintained at the proper temperature outside of necessary periods of preparation and service. The labels on the foil covering the bowls indicate the contents will also be served for supper. | ||
2020-01-09 | 251.09(2)(bm) | Infant & Toddler - Sleep Position |
Description: A 7 month old infant is observed to be sleeping in a swing that has been fully reclined and placed on the floor. A one year old toddler is observed to be asleep in an infant carrier car seat that has been placed inside a Pack N Play. There is no statement from either of the children's physician's on file authorizing these sleep positions. | ||
2020-01-09 | 251.07(6)(dm)4. | Medical Log - Reviewing Injury Records |
Description: There is no documentation in the medical log demonstrating that the required 6 month review was completed. | ||
2020-01-09 | 251.07(5)(a)6. | Menus - Changes |
Description: Changes to the menu were not recorded when beefaroni, green beans, applesauce and milk were reported to have been served for lunch on 1/9/20. The menu indicates beefaoni, peaches, peas, bread and milk was served. | ||
2020-01-09 | 251.06(2)(a) | Potential Source Of Harm On Premises |
Description: Blankets used to cover a child were not kept away from the child's mouth and nose when the infant room teacher placed a thick blanket over a napping 7 month old infant. The blanket completely covered the infant's entire body, face, and head. Sharp metal is accessible to children in the outdoor play space on top of a metal storage unit. | ||
2019-12-01 | Licensing | Second Probationary License Due To Noncompliance |
2019-10-30 | 251.06(7)(a) | Indoor Space - Square Footage Per Child |
Description: Children were not provided with the required 35 square feet of usable indoor space when 5 children were cared for in the infant classroom. The maximum number of children that can be cared for in the infant classroom at one time is 4. | ||
2019-10-15 | Licensing | Orders Letter |
2019-10-03 | 251.06(9)(f)3. | Food - Leftover Prepared Food |
Description: A container of leftover cooked ham dated 9/30/19 is observed in the refrigerator. The ham has not been discarded within 36 hours as required. | ||
2019-10-03 | 251.06(9)(d)1.a. | Food Storage - Perishable, Potentially Hazardous Food |
Description: Prepared food (egg and cheese omelets) was kept in the preschool classroom rather than maintained continuously at the proper temperature outside of necessary periods of preparation and service. The omelets were prepared at 7:00 A.M. and served at 7:40 A.M. and again at 8:20 A.M. | ||
2019-10-03 | 251.09(1)(am) | Infant & Toddler - Intake Information |
Description: An Infant/Toddler Intake form is unable to be located for Child #5. | ||
2019-10-03 | 251.09(3)(a)7. | Infant & Toddler - Leftover Milk Or Formula |
Description: A cup of milk that was brought from home for Child #5 is observed in the infant room refrigerator. The cup is not dated and staff are unable to state when the cup is from. Child #5 has not been in attendance on the day of the visit. | ||
2019-10-03 | 251.06(9)(b)3. | Manual Dishwashing - 3-Step Procedure |
Description: Per the report of staff, the 3 step manual dishwashing procedure is not followed when washing dishes. Step 3, the sanitizing step, is not being implemented when washing dishes. | ||
2019-10-03 | 251.06(2)(a) | Potential Source Of Harm On Premises |
Description: Areas observed in outdoor play space where the green indoor/outdoor carpet that has been placed under the mulch is coming through and sticking up posing a tripping hazard. |
